What is Decimal Fraction?

A decimal fraction in Elementary Algebra is a fraction whose denominator is a power of 10, so the number can be written with a decimal point. That means 7/10 becomes 0.7, 35/100 becomes 0.35, and 4/1000 becomes 0.004.

The place value system is what makes this work. Each place to the right of the decimal point stands for tenths, hundredths, thousandths, and so on, which is why decimal fractions line up with powers of 10. If you know the place value, you can move between fraction form and decimal form without guessing.

A decimal fraction is not a different kind of number from a regular fraction, it is just a fraction written in a base-10 form. That is why 0.6 and 6/10 mean the same value, and 0.06 is much smaller than 0.6 because the 6 is in the hundredths place instead of the tenths place.

This term shows up a lot when you simplify expressions, compare numbers, or do operations with money and measurements. For example, 2.5 is really 2 and 5 tenths, while 0.25 is 25 hundredths. The digits matter more than the number of zeros you see, so students often need to slow down and read the place value carefully.

Decimal fractions also connect to other common decimal forms in algebra, like decimal notation and decimal expansion. If a value has only a finite number of digits after the decimal point, it is a terminating decimal, which often makes it easy to convert back into a decimal fraction. When you see a decimal in a problem, you are often working with a fraction disguised in base-10 form.

Why Decimal Fraction matters in Elementary Algebra

Decimal fractions show up everywhere in Elementary Algebra because they make fractional values easier to compare, calculate with, and write in real-world problems. Instead of carrying around fractions like 3/10 or 47/100, you can work with 0.3 and 0.47, which is often faster when you are adding, subtracting, or estimating.

This term also bridges the gap between fraction skills and decimal skills. If you can recognize that 0.125 means 125/1000, you are better prepared to simplify numbers, round them correctly, and check whether an answer makes sense. That matters in measurement problems, money problems, and any word problem where the decimal point changes the value.

Decimal fractions also train you to pay attention to place value, which is a major habit in algebra. A lot of mistakes happen when a student reads 0.5 and 0.05 as if they were close in size. Knowing they are 5 tenths and 5 hundredths helps you compare values, order numbers, and estimate answers without treating the decimal point like a decoration.

Later, this skill supports more advanced work with ratios, rates, and equations because decimals are just another way to represent fractional parts of a whole. Once you can move comfortably between fraction form and decimal form, many problems become easier to set up and check.

Decimal Fraction vs Decimal

Decimal is the number written in base-10 notation, while decimal fraction is the fraction behind that decimal, with a denominator that is a power of 10. For example, 0.34 is a decimal, and 34/100 is the decimal fraction form of the same value. Students often mix them up because they represent the same number in two different ways.

Frequently asked questions about Decimal Fraction

What is decimal fraction in Elementary Algebra?

A decimal fraction is a fraction written with a denominator that is a power of 10, like 3/10, 27/100, or 45/1000. In decimal form, those become 0.3, 0.27, and 0.045. The decimal point shows the place value of each digit.

How do you convert a decimal fraction to a fraction?

Read the digits after the decimal point as a number over 10, 100, 1000, and so on, depending on how many decimal places there are. For example, 0.8 = 8/10 and 0.36 = 36/100. Then simplify if the fraction has a common factor.

Is 0.5 a decimal fraction?

Yes. 0.5 is the decimal form of 5/10, which is a fraction with a denominator of 10. It is a decimal fraction because it fits the base-10 pattern and can be written as a power-of-10 fraction.

Why does place value matter for decimal fractions?

Place value tells you exactly what each digit means, so 0.4, 0.04, and 0.004 are not close in size. The 4 moves from tenths to hundredths to thousandths, which makes the number smaller each time. That idea shows up constantly when you compare, round, and calculate with decimals.
